>Description:
If you use an old netbsd CD because you have no money to buy a new one and no 
cd burner and no money to buy a cd burner, then ftp fails because the new 
directory does not have kern.tgz but kern-GENERIC.tgz and kern-GENERIC.MP.tgz.  
In addition, of course, it behooves one to change the ftp directory to 
NetBSD-5.0.1 instead of NetBSD-1.5 or whatever.

It would be nice if a very small blurb was added about this somewhere in some 
docs.  Like "Installing from a pre-version-X CD".  

I think there also might be a couple other missing sets, but I don't recall and 
so I'll find out shortly, and so this is another reason why there should be a 
small docs paragraph about this.
